From Waves to Volcanoes: A Day in Costa Rica’s Heartland

Trading surfboards for hiking boots, my wife and I embarked on a full-day tour to the Arenal Volcano. From coffee plantations to hot springs, join us as we explore the heart of Costa Rica.

A Journey Through Costa Rica’s Heart

The day began with the sun peeking over the horizon, casting a golden glow over San José. My wife and I, always on the lookout for new adventures, decided to take a break from the waves and explore the lush landscapes of Costa Rica’s interior. Our destination? The majestic Arenal Volcano, a towering presence that promised a day filled with discovery and relaxation.

Our guide, Alex, greeted us with a warm smile and a promise of a day to remember. As we set off, the scenic route to Arenal unfolded before us, revealing a tapestry of farms, rainforests, and quaint towns. Our first stop was a coffee plantation, where the rich aroma of freshly roasted beans filled the air. As a surfer, I’m used to early mornings, and a good cup of coffee is essential. Here, we learned about the intricate process of coffee production, from bean to cup, and sampled some of the finest brews Costa Rica has to offer.

Nature’s Wonders and Culinary Delights

The journey continued to the La Paz Waterfall, a breathtaking cascade surrounded by vibrant rainforest. Alex, ever the entertainer, snapped photos of us with our mouths open, pretending to catch the waterfall’s flow. It was a lighthearted moment that captured the essence of the day—fun, laughter, and a deep appreciation for nature’s beauty.

Next, we visited a hummingbird station, where the air buzzed with the rapid flutter of wings. Here, we were treated to a unique beverage—hot sugar cane juice with a splash of tangerine lemonade. The combination was unexpectedly delightful, a sweet and tangy refreshment that paired perfectly with the queso tortilla, a corn-based treat topped with sour cream.

Lunch in La Fortuna was a feast for the senses. I opted for the Chifrijo, a hearty bowl of rice, beans, fried pork, tortilla chips, and avocado. It was a dish that mirrored the vibrant flavors of Costa Rica, each bite a reminder of the country’s rich culinary heritage.

Soaking in Serenity

As the afternoon sun began to wane, we arrived at the Paradise Hot Springs. Nestled in lush gardens, the hot springs offered a serene escape from the day’s adventures. My wife and I rolled up our pants and dipped our feet into the warm, mineral-rich waters, letting the soothing heat wash over us. It was a moment of pure relaxation, a chance to unwind and reflect on the day’s experiences.

The day concluded with a delicious dinner, a fitting end to a journey that had taken us through the heart of Costa Rica. As we made our way back to San José, I couldn’t help but feel grateful for the opportunity to explore this beautiful country beyond its famous surf spots. The Arenal Volcano tour was a reminder that adventure awaits around every corner, and sometimes, the best waves are found not in the ocean, but in the experiences we share with those we love.

Pura vida, my friends, until the next adventure!
